PERMACULTURE DESIGN COURSES: Taught by Dan Hemneway, director of American Permaculture Training (APT) programs, recipient of the Permaculture Community Service Award and of diplomas in education, media, site development, design, and community service from the Permaculture Institute, Stanley, Tasmania. Course inbludes sections on ecological design principles, design application of appropriate technologies, and economic, social, and legal considerations in permaculture design. Students form design teams and design the course site. Graduates certified as Permaculture Design Apprentices and registered with the Permaculture Institute and the Permaculture Institute of North America. The three-week intensive course includes about 150 hours of instruction plus field word and presentations by selected course enrollees. June 30-July 19-Slippery Rock University.
